Captain Stanley (Ray Winstone) captures fugitive Burns brothers Charley (Guy Pearce) and Mikey (Richard Wilson) at the scene of bloody rape and murder. Informing Charley that he must kill his older brother, Arthur (Danny Huston), in order to be set free, Stanley drags Mikey to a decrepit jailhouse while he waits for Charley to carry out the deed... Director John Hillcoat's second collaboration with musician Nick Cave (here contributing the film's screenplay and soundtrack with Warren Ellis) is a taut character study of desperation amid the mesmerising backdrop of the 19th century Australian outback.
